libncurses.so.5 rpm离线包
时间: 2023-12-03 17:00:26 浏览: 132
libncurses.so.5是一个 Linux 系统中的共享库文件,它提供了文本模式下的终端控制功能,使得开发者能够创建具有高互动性的终端应用程序。
.rpm 是 Red Hat Package Manager 的缩写,是用于管理软件包的一种格式。离线包则是指没有网络连接的情况下通过本地的方式安装软件包。
libncurses.so.5 rpm离线包是指包含了 libncurses.so.5 文件的 RPM 格式的软件包,并且可以在没有网络连接的情况下通过本地方式进行安装。
如果你想要获取 libncurses.so.5 rpm离线包,可以执行以下步骤:
1. 首先,在互联网连接正常的情况下,在软件包管理系统(如 YUM 或 DNF)中搜索 libncurses.so.5 rpm 包。
2. 下载符合你系统版本和架构的 libncurses.so.5 rpm包。通常,下载的文件会以 .rpm 扩展名结尾。
3. 将下载的 .rpm 文件拷贝到离线的机器上,可以使用 USB 存储设备、网络传输或其他合适的方式。
4. 在离线的机器上打开终端,并使用软件包管理工具(如 YUM 或 DNF)进行安装。运行以下命令:
`sudo rpm -i <package_name.rpm>`
这将安装 libncurses.so.5 rpm离线包,使其文件和依赖项被正确部署到系统中。
通过以上步骤,你可以在离线的环境中获取并安装 libncurses.so.5 rpm离线包,以便在终端应用程序中使用它所提供的功能。
相关问题
linux 离线安装 libncurses.so.5
要在Linux中离线安装libncurses.so.5,可以按照以下步骤进行:
1. 在能够联网的机器上,去官方网站或其他可靠的软件来源网站下载libncurses.so.5的安装包。确保下载的版本与目标机器的操作系统和位数相符。
2. 将安装包从联网机器复制到目标机器。可以使用USB闪存驱动器、网络共享或其他合适的方式来进行复制。
3. 在目标机器上打开终端,并切换到存放安装包的目录。
4. 使用命令解压安装包。通常使用tar命令来解压,比如:tar -zxvf libncurses.so.5.tar.gz
5. 解压后,进入解压目录中。使用cd命令,比如:cd libncurses.so.5
6. 运行安装命令。通常以root或sudo权限运行安装命令。例如,可以运行make命令进行编译和安装。
7. 确认安装完成。在终端输入以下命令:ldd libncurses.so.5。如果显示库文件已定位,则表示安装成功。
值得注意的是,在离线安装过程中可能会遇到依赖性问题,需要额外安装其他库文件。如果出现这种情况,可以按照类似的步骤解决依赖问题,先离线安装缺失的库文件,然后再安装libncurses.so.5。
libncurses.so.6 下载
libncurses.so.6 是一个与终端界面交互的库文件,常用于开发命令行工具和终端应用程序。如果需要下载 libncurses.so.6,可以按照以下步骤进行:
1. 首先,打开一个终端窗口,可以使用Ctrl+Alt+T快捷键,或者在应用程序菜单中找到终端。
2. 确保你的系统已经连接到互联网,可以使用ping命令来检查网络连接状态。输入以下命令并按Enter键:
ping www.baidu.com
如果网络连接正常,将会显示与www.baidu.com的ping响应。
3. 安装libncurses.so.6。在大多数Linux发行版上,可以使用包管理器来安装库文件。不同的发行版具有不同的包管理器。以下是一些常见的包管理器命令示例:
- Debian/Ubuntu系统上,使用apt命令安装:
sudo apt install libncurses6
- Red Hat/CentOS系统上,使用yum命令安装:
sudo yum install ncurses-libs
- Fedora系统上,使用dnf命令安装:
sudo dnf install ncurses-libs
- Arch Linux系统上,使用pacman命令安装:
sudo pacman -S ncurses
如果你使用的是其他Linux发行版,可以根据其包管理器的规范自行查找和安装相应的包。
4. 等待安装完成。包管理器将自动下载并安装libncurses.so.6及其依赖项。这可能需要一些时间,取决于你的网络连接速度和系统性能。
5. 完成后,你应该可以在系统中使用libncurses.so.6了。你可以通过在终端中键入以下命令来验证安装是否成功:
ldd /path/to/your/executable | grep ncurses
将 /path/to/your/executable 替换为你要运行的可执行文件的路径。如果成功安装了libncurses.so.6,该命令将会输出包含"libncurses.so.6"的行。
希望以上解答对你有帮助!